**Mgmt Meeting Minutes — Retiring the Brightline Range**

Quick recap for sales leads at Fenholt Supplies: we agreed to retire the Brightline fixture range by year-end. Remaining stock moves to clearance pricing next month, and accounts on standing orders get migrated to the Lumetta range. Trade-in incentives were approved in principle. The confidential note on next steps sits just below.

board note of bajof-bajeg: The pricing group signed off on a budget of $13.4 million for Project Sildor. The renewal with Lamixek Holdings closes at $48.9 million a year, 49 percent above the last contract.

## Data stores: firmware update channel

Welcome aboard! The Wrenbolt update channel tracks which firmware build each device fleet should pull. Rollouts go stable → beta → canary in reverse, weirdly — canary gets builds first. Don't edit channel assignments by hand; use the rollout CLI so the audit table stays honest. If you need to poke at the channel tables directly, connect with the string below.

replica DSN, kajep-yahag: mssql://praok_svc:iF@db-8d68.plorvaio.local:5432/eliion

Plugin authors: do not open PRs against the scheduling engine directly; file a proposal first. Plugin API contracts are frozen per minor release. Breaking changes require two weeks' notice on the plugins channel. Restock-forecast internals, slot-mapping logic, and the machine-inventory schema are all in scope here; UI themes are not. Questions about plugin certification go to the working group. Final approval on any plugin API change rests with the maintainer listed below.

named custodian: Brivan Eliath Quenox Frador

The FY marketing budget for Greystone Provisions is being cut by 18%, effective next quarter. The reduction falls mainly on brand campaigns and event sponsorship; digital acquisition spend is preserved at current levels. Savings of roughly one-sixth of the annual discretionary pool will be redirected toward the Larchfield warehouse automation programme. Regional allocations have been rebalanced accordingly, with the Dunmere territory taking the largest share of the cut. The underlying strategic rationale appears in the note below.

internal memo for kaduf-baduf: Only 35 of the 378 pilot accounts renewed Holir, so a churn review is set for June 11. Eliielax Group is in early talks to buy Silaelix Group for about $142.1 million.